Compare Revisions
Personnaliser Firefox par l’utilisation du fichier policies.json
Revision 267419:
Revision 267419 by Y.D. on
Revision 286650:
Revision 286650 by Mozinet on
Keywords:
Search results summary:
La prise en charge d'une stratégie multiplateforme peut être mise en œuvre en utilisant un fichier JSON appelé policies.json.
La prise en charge d'une stratégie multiplateforme peut être mise en œuvre en utilisant un fichier JSON appelé policies.json.
Maudhui:
La prise en charge des stratégies peut être mise en œuvre en utilisant un fichier JSON appelé policies.json. À la différence du contrôle de Firefox par l’[[Customizing Firefox Using Group Policy|utilisation des stratégies de groupe]], l’usage de policies.json est multiplateforme, ce qui en fait la méthode préférée dans les environnements d’entreprise où coexistent des stations de travail fonctionnant sous différents systèmes d’exploitation.
Pour mettre en place la prise en charge de cette statégie, un fichier <code>policies.json</code> doit être créé. Ce fichier est placé dans un répertoire nommé <code>distribution</code> à l’intérieur du répertoire d’installation de Firefox. Ce répertoire n’existe normalement pas par défaut, il faut donc le créer manuellement.
Le fichier <code>policies.json</code> se présente comme ceci :
{
"policies": {
"BlockAboutConfig": true
}
}
Dans cet exemple, nous avons réglé le paramètre de stratégie <code>BlockAboutConfig</code> sur <code>true</code>, ce qui signifie que l’utilisateur n’aura pas accès à la page <code>about:config</code>.
Les dernières informations sur nos stratégies sont disponibles en anglais à l’adresse https://github.com/mozilla/policy-templates/ ou depuis la page de Firefox '''about:policies#documentation'''.
{note}'''Remarque :''' la méthode expliquée ci-dessus ne fonctionne pas si Firefox est déjà géré par les stratégies de groupe.{/note}
[[Template:enterprise]]
La prise en charge des stratégies peut être mise en œuvre en utilisant un fichier JSON appelé '''policies.json'''. À la différence du contrôle de Firefox par l’[[Customizing Firefox Using Group Policy|utilisation des stratégies de groupe]], l’usage de <code>policies.json</code> est multiplateforme, ce qui en fait la méthode préférée dans les environnements d’entreprise où coexistent des stations de travail fonctionnant sous différents systèmes d’exploitation.
Pour mettre en place la prise en charge de cette statégie, un fichier <code>policies.json</code> doit être créé. Sous Windows, créez un répertoire nommé '''<code>distribution</code>'''. Sous macOS, le fichier va dans '''<code>Firefox.app/Contents/Resources/distribution</code>'''. Sous Linux, le fichier va dans '''<code>firefox/distribution</code>''', où '''<code>firefox</code>''' est le répertoire d’installation de Firefox qui dépend de votre distribution. Vous pouvez aussi spécifier une stratéfie côté système en plaçant le ficier dans '''<code>/etc/firefox/policies</code>'''.
Le fichier <code>policies.json</code> se présente comme ceci :
{
"policies": {
"BlockAboutConfig": true
}
}
Dans cet exemple, nous avons réglé le paramètre de stratégie '''<code>BlockAboutConfig</code>''' sur <'''code>true</code>''', ce qui signifie que l’utilisateur ou l’utilisatrice n’a pas accès à la page ''about:config''.
'''Les dernières informations sur nos stratégies sont disponibles en anglais à l’adresse https://github.com/mozilla/policy-templates/ ou depuis la page de Firefox ''about:policies#documentation''.'''
{note}'''Note :''' la méthode expliquée ci-dessus ne fonctionne pas si Firefox est déjà géré par les stratégies de groupe.{/note}